From 5509b69908ba8d9d21ac467f7c0dd60325b278b5 Mon Sep 17 00:00:00 2001 From: Simon Vieille Date: Sat, 25 Apr 2020 16:04:54 +0200 Subject: [PATCH] fix #11 --- src/SideMenu.vue |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/src/SideMenu.vue b/src/SideMenu.vue index 8e05002..f664a23 100644 --- a/src/SideMenu.vue +++ b/src/SideMenu.vue @@ -86,9 +86,12 @@ export default { this.retrieveLogo(); const menu = document.querySelector('#appmenu') - const config = {attributes: true, childList: true, subtree: true}; - const observer = new MutationObserver(this.retrieveApps); - observer.observe(menu, config); + + if (menu) { + const config = {attributes: true, childList: true, subtree: true}; + const observer = new MutationObserver(this.retrieveApps); + observer.observe(menu, config); + } } }